A talk about why and how we might respond to the climate and nature crises. Given by Information Officer, Ruth Jarman, at All Saints, Westbury-on-Trym, June 2025

This is a 13 minute talk suggesting why Christians might want to nurture and protect the natural world. Because it is our motivation that will then be able to carry us through the many obstacles to action – our culture, economic pressures, the “it’s too late” and “what we do makes no difference”. I move quickly on to the “so what do we do?”
